Optimizing early weaning protocols for Burbot larvae

Moureen Matuha,
Luke P. Oliver,
Timothy J. Bruce
et al.

Abstract: Burbot (Lota lota maculosa) hold enormous potential for freshwater commercial aquaculture. Current larval burbot rearing involves providing live prey for initial feeding. Two trials were conducted to investigate the reduction of live prey for larval burbot. In Trial 1, five treatments were evaluated: the control group (C) received rotifers (Brachionus plicatilis) and Artemia spp. from 11‐50 days post‐hatch (DPH).
